| Pearl Jam – Man of the Hour Lyrics | 18 years ago |
|
It is obviously about a man saying goodbye to his father, his relationship with his father, and really every man`s relationship with their father. "And the doors are open now as the bells are ringing out" most likely about the funeral, the doors of the church is open and the church bells are ringing "young men they pretend Old men comprehend." What every young and old man does, the young try to act better, superior, the old understand the young, because they were once young themselves "And the road The old man paved The broken seams along the way The rusted signs, left just for me He was guiding me, love, his own way Now the man of the hour is taking his final bow As the curtain comes down I feel that this is just goodbye for now." What every father tries to do with their son, guide them, help them understand life and teach them about life. just want to say, this is one of the few movies and songs that have brought me near to tears |
